On ubuntu 10.04 I too had noticed that running emacs -nw inside byobu/tmux/screen was using different colours from emacs -nw in the regular gnome-terminal.
I found that this is because byobu was setting TERM to screen-bce. Then setting TERM to xterm (for me, in the normal gnome-terminal TERM=xterm) gave me the same syntax highlighting when not running through byobu/screen.
So still not sure what the proper solution is.
